58-Year-Old Woman Pronounced Dead after Three-Vehicle Collision near Winter Freeway

ABILENE, TX (June 10, 2024) – Saturday afternoon, Nicole Nash was killed in a three-car crash on Danville Drive.

Police officers responded to the scene around 12:15 p.m., at the 3200 block of North Danville Drive on May 18th.

Investigators say Nash was driving a 2000 Honda Accord north on Danville Drive, and suddenly veered left before entering the on-ramp to Winter’s Freeway.

The Honda then crashed into the side of a 2023 GMC Yukon and a 2015 Audi in the northbound lanes. Medical personnel pronounced 58-year-old Nash dead at the scene due to the extent of her condition.

Following preliminary duties, authorities ruled out intoxication as a potential factor.

The medical examiner’s office performed an autopsy on Nash to determine the cause of the crash. No updates are available at this time.
